Development and experiments of the gravity vertical gradient measuring system based on the laser interferometry

  • This paper develops a new apparatus for measuring the vertical gravity gradient based on the laser interferometry. The apparatus uses the method of dual optical interferometer to determine the time shifting coordinates of dual free-fall bodies spaced 50 cm vertically, and then calculates the gravity gradient by using differential algorithm. In design and development of this instrument, particular attention is paid to those aspects which would affect synchronistically automatic control of the free-fall bodies and vertical adjustment of the dual measuring beams. The results of the experiments show that the apparatus can obtain the interference signals of these two free-fall bodies during the freely falling and complete the measurement of the gravity gradient with accuracy better than 100 E.
